Fostoria man is charged with kidnapping woman

10/27/2003

ARLINGTON, Ohio — A Fostoria man was charged Saturday with crimes related to the alleged kidnapping of a Findlay woman, Hancock County sheriff's deputies said yesterday.

James Mosier, 24, was charged with kidnapping, domestic violence, disrupting public service, criminal damaging, and assault. He was being held at the Hancock County jail.

At 2:15 a.m. Saturday, deputies responded to a home in Arlington, where they learned Mr. Mosier had been involved in a dispute with his girlfriend and another woman.

Deputies said Mr. Mosier took Kristen Stuard, 22, from the residence by force. State troopers later stopped him and took him into custody. Ms. Stuard was not injured.
